Age-Appropriate Nutrition for Children
Children's nutritional needs evolve rapidly from infancy through adolescence. Each life stage has different requirements for energy, protein, calcium, iron, and vitamins. Understanding these broad principles helps parents plan meals that support healthy growth and development.
- ✓Toddlers (1–3): iron-rich foods critical; variety of textures to build acceptance
- ✓School age (4–12): adequate calcium for bone development; varied food groups
- ✓Adolescents (13–18): increased iron needs (especially girls); higher energy requirements
- ✓All ages: limit ultra-processed foods, added sugar, and excessive sodium
- ✓A family meal pattern is the single strongest predictor of healthy eating in children
Strategies for Fussy Eaters
Food aversion in children is extremely common and usually temporary. Research-backed strategies focus on repeated exposure without pressure, presenting new foods alongside accepted ones, and maintaining a positive meal environment.
- ✓Expose new foods repeatedly without forcing consumption (takes 10–15+ exposures for acceptance)
- ✓Serve new foods alongside 'safe' foods the child already enjoys
- ✓Involve children in food shopping and preparation — ownership increases willingness
- ✓Avoid using food as reward or punishment — it distorts food relationships
